What is HCI Group's long-term investments?
HCI Group (HCI) reported long-term investments of $1.11B in Q1 2026.
How has HCI Group's long-term investments changed year-over-year?
HCI Group's long-term investments increased by 36.7% year-over-year, from $808.41M to $1.11B.
What is the long-term trend for HCI Group's long-term investments?
Over 5 years (2020 to 2025), HCI Group's long-term investments has grown at a 28.5%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$225.72M to $789.66M.
What does long-term investments mean?
Equity investments, venture capital, strategic stakes, and other investments with holding periods expected to exceed one year.
